Introduction
The DW-3.0/20 Air-Cooled Low Noise Industrial Propane Process Compressor Co Acetylene Gas Compressor is a piston compressor that excels in gas pressurization and delivery. It comprises a working chamber, transmission parts, body, and auxiliary components. The working chamber directly compresses the gas, while the piston, driven by the piston rod, moves back and forth within the cylinder. As the piston moves, the volume of the working chamber alternates, resulting in a decrease in volume on one side and an increase on the other. This process increases the gas pressure, allowing it to be discharged through the valve, or absorbed when the pressure is reduced.

About the Product
The diaphragm compressor is an essential component in various industries, such as manufacturing, oil and gas, and chemical plants. It is designed to separate the gas from the hydraulic oil system, ensuring the purity of the gas and preventing any pollution. The advanced manufacturing technology and accurate membrane cavity design ensure a long service life of the diaphragm.
The diaphragm compressor consists of a motor, base, crankcase, crankshaft linkage mechanism, cylinder components, piston, oil and gas pipeline, electric control system, and other accessories. It can compress a wide range of gases, including ammonia, propylene, nitrogen, oxygen, helium, hydrogen, and more.
Main Features:
No leakage: The compressor membrane head is sealed by a static “O” ring, ensuring no gas leakage during compression.
Corrosion resistance: The compressor membrane head is made of 316L stainless steel, and the diaphragm is made of 301 stainless steel, providing excellent corrosion resistance.
Small tightening torque: The “O” ring seal reduces the flange bolt tightening torque, resulting in shorter maintenance downtime.

Product Description
An acetylene compressor is a specialized compressor designed for compressing acetylene gas to high pressures. It is essential for safely transporting and storing acetylene gas in various industrial applications.
The acetylene compressor typically consists of 2 or 3 stage reciprocating compressors with intercoolers, aftercoolers, and moisture separators. These components ensure the safe and efficient compression of the gas.
These compressors are made from materials that resist the corrosive nature of acetylene and operate at high pressures of up to 300 psi. Due to the high risk of explosion, the safety of acetylene compressors is of utmost importance, and they must be designed and maintained according to strict safety standards.

Product Description
A diaphragm compressor is a reciprocating compressor that utilizes the reciprocating motion of the diaphragm to compress and transport gas. Unlike traditional compressors, the diaphragm compressor features a unique design that ensures a large compression ratio, a wide pressure range, and excellent sealing characteristics.
The diaphragm, clamped by two restraint plates, forms a cylinder in which it moves back and forth under hydraulic force. This movement enables the compression and transportation of gas with utmost efficiency. As the gas chamber of the diaphragm compressor requires no lubrication, it guarantees the purity of the compressed gas. This makes it particularly suitable for compressing and transporting flammable, explosive, toxic, and high-purity gases.

Product Description
A piston compressor is a type of reciprocating compressor that utilizes piston motion to compress and deliver gas. It consists of a working chamber, transmission parts, body, and auxiliary components. The working chamber compresses the gas, while the piston, driven by the piston rod, moves back and forth in the cylinder. This reciprocating motion alternately changes the volume of the working chamber, resulting in pressure increase and gas discharge through the valve, as well as pressure reduction and gas absorption through another valve.
Main Components:
Motion system: crankshaft, piston connecting rod assembly, coupling, etc.
Air distribution system: valve plate, valve spring, etc.
Sealing system: piston ring, oil seal, gasket, packing, etc.
Body system: crankcase, cylinder block, cylinder liner, cover plate, etc.
Safety and energy regulation systems: safety valves, energy regulation devices, etc.
